The countdown to one of Tamil cinema’s most eagerly awaited releases of the year just got real. Karuppu, the fantasy action entertainer starring Suriya and Trisha Krishnan, directed by RJ Balaji, is heading to theatres on May 14, 2026 — and its official runtime and CBFC certification have now been confirmed. Here is everything you need to know before buying your tickets.

Karuppu Runtime and CBFC Certification: The Official Numbers

According to the certification issued by the Central Board of Film Certification (CBFC), Karuppu has been rated UA 13+. The runtime is listed as 150.47 minutes — approximately 2 hours and 30 minutes — which is typical for an action film.

A UA 13+ rating means the film is suitable for general audiences, with parental guidance suggested for children under 13. This is a positive signal for the makers — it positions Karuppu as a broad family entertainer without restrictive viewing limitations, which should help maximise footfall across multiplex and single-screen theatres alike.

What Is Karuppu About?

Karuppu is set in a world gripped by chaos, where fear, injustice, and suffering have become part of everyday life. Amid this turmoil, a mysterious man emerges as an unlikely superhero who confronts personal struggles and harsh realities before gradually discovering his strength and purpose.

Think of it as a grounded-yet-fantastical tale of an ordinary man thrust into extraordinary circumstances — very much in the spirit of fantasy action films that blend mythological undertones with modern storytelling. Apart from Suriya and Trisha, the film also features Indrans, Natty Subramaniam, Swasika, Sshivada, Anagha Maaya Ravi, Supreeth Reddy, and Yogi Babu in key roles. \

There has been a buzz of curiosity around Trisha’s role specifically. Recently, the makers released a teaser introducing Trisha Krishnan as her character Preethi. After the teaser went viral, many fans wondered why the actress was absent from the film’s audio launch — to which Trisha humorously remarked that her invitation must have gotten lost in the mail. What’s Next for Suriya and Trisha After Karuppu?

The film is just one piece of a very busy 2026 for both its leads. After Karuppu, Suriya will next appear in Vishwanath and Sons, directed by Venky Atluri — an emotionally driven romantic drama with Mamitha Baiju as the co-lead and Raveena Tandon in a pivotal role, slated to hit theatres in July 2026. He has also begun work on a cop action-comedy tentatively titled Suriya 47, directed by Jithu Madhavan, starring Nazriya Nazim as the female lead.

On the other hand, Trisha Krishnan is awaiting the release of Vishwambhara, starring Chiranjeevi, which does not yet have a confirmed release date. As of now, the actress has not announced any new projects.
